eb9467e2e148f4fcd33f86b5c1ef2e6554c82610f0786586a7145f7a4c890b10

769441 (305 blocks ago)

147955381

⏴ Block 769440 (261e180e...8af) | Block 769442 ⏵ | Latest block ⏭

Metadata

30/4/25, 5:54 am UTC (10:10:23 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.9269 SENT

Transactions (0)

Show raw details